The loss of Cambodia's territorial integrity

Cambodia, a land once beautiful, proud, independent, sovereign, neutral and prosperous, is now facing several mortal dangers. One of these dangers is Her continued loss of territorial integrity to Her neighbours. Vietnamese encroachments upon the Khmer territory continue unabated with the Royal Government of Cambodia turning a blind eye completely to these serious problems.

The leaders of the present Royal Government of Cambodia, for their own selfish and personal ambitions and interests, have never acted, do not act and will never act to prevent these illegal and outrageous encroachments, much less attempt to restore Cambodia's territorial integrity to that of the golden era of Sangkum Reastr Niyum.

Unfortunately, but expectedly the Supreme National Council on Border Affairs presided by His Majesty, the King-Father Norodom Sihanouk was killed before it was even born by a new royal decree of June 14, 2005 which granted full authority to Mr. Hun Sen, the Prime Minister of Cambodia to resolve the border problems.

The sole person who can tackle successfully these very complex and difficult border demarcation problems with Cambodia's ambitious neighbours is none other than His Majesty, the King-Father Norodom Sihanouk. Norodom Sihanouk known as Samdech Euv is Cambodia's last and only hope to get back what She has lost to Her neighbours.
